Russia is building a new naval base in the Black Sea

Aslan Bzhania, the leader of Abkhazia, which declared independence from Georgia, announced that Russia plans to establish a naval base on Abkhazia’s Black Sea coast.

Bzhania met with Russian President Vladimir Putin yesterday. According to Izvestia news, Bzhania said that an agreement was signed for a permanent naval base in the Ochamchira region.

“We signed the agreement and in the near future there will be a permanent base of the Russian navy in the Ochamchira region,” Bzhania said. “This agreement is aimed at increasing the defense capabilities of both Russia and Abkhazia, and such interactions will continue,” he said.

After Russian troops repelled Georgia’s attempt to retake South Ossetia in a five-day war that ended on August 12, 2008, Russia recognized the independence of Abkhazia and the other breakaway region, South Ossetia. (Reuters)
